Overview of Logistics Equipment Management and Monitoring System
Logistics Equipment Management and Monitoring System (WMCS) is an important tool for managing and monitoring the unit cargo receiving, sending, storage and distribution tasks of the automated logistics system. It realizes efficient scheduling and real-time monitoring of logistics equipment by integrating the business management layer, logistics equipment management and monitoring layer and equipment control layer.
Comparison of Standard Frameworks
| Hierarchy | Functional Description | Information Interaction |
|---|---|---|
| Business Management Layer | Management of receiving, sending, storage and distribution tasks, including basic data definition and business plan formulation. | Exchanges material definition information, storage area definition information and business document information with the logistics equipment management and monitoring layer. |
| Logistics equipment management and monitoring layer | Decompose batch tasks, generate unit operations, and assign them to relevant logistics equipment. Monitor the execution of operations in real time and feedback the results. | Exchange business document information and business execution information with the business management layer; exchange equipment operation instruction information, equipment operation status information and equipment operation status information with the equipment control layer. |
| Equipment control layer | Control logistics equipment to automatically perform tasks according to operation instructions, such as the operation and monitoring of stackers, conveyors and other equipment. | Receive equipment operation instructions and feedback the execution results. |
Technology evolution analysis
The functional system of the logistics equipment management and monitoring system has evolved from single equipment control to comprehensive business management. Early systems focused on the operating status of individual equipment, while modern WMCSs have achieved intelligent management of the entire logistics system by integrating job management, scheduling models, and equipment monitoring modules.
Implementation recommendations
1. System selection and integration
When selecting a WMCS, its functional modules should be determined based on the actual needs of the enterprise. For example, a system that only needs to store ledger management can be simplified to a WMCS, while a system that fully monitors equipment operation requires full WMCS functions.
2. Data acquisition and communication
Ensure real-time data transmission between the equipment control layer and the logistics equipment management and monitoring layer. It is recommended to use a reliable communication protocol (such as Modbus or Profinet) to ensure data accuracy and stability.
3. Job Scheduling Optimization
Use intelligent algorithms to optimize job decomposition and equipment scheduling, reduce equipment idle time, and improve logistics efficiency. For example, use a path planning algorithm to determine the optimal equipment usage sequence.
4. System Maintenance and Upgrade
Regularly check the operating status of system hardware and software, and repair equipment failures in a timely manner. At the same time, update WMCS functional modules according to business needs, such as adding support for new cargo types or optimizing the inventory query interface.
